Greater Columbus Community Helping
Greater Columbus Community Helping reported paying Melanie Cage, Executive Di, $85,000 in total compensation (FY 2024).
That places Melanie Cage at approximately the 87th percentile among 38 similarly sized philanthropy & grantmaking nonprofits (median $43,290).
$193,012Total revenue (FY 2024)
$85,000Total executive compensation
87thPercentile vs. peers
